Binnelanders – Season 7
In Binnelanders – Season 7, the long-running South African drama series returned to its original focus: the daily operations and personal conflicts within the Binneland Kliniek. This season, which premiered on April 4, 2011, marked a shift from the previous season’s legal firm storyline. The show reverted to a half-hour daily soap format, centering again on the medical staff, patients, and their intertwined lives in Pretoria. Key characters faced new challenges, both professional and personal, as the series re-established its identity as a hospital-centric drama.
Binnelanders – Season 7 Plot Summary
Season 7 of Binnelanders began with the series shedding its “Sub Judice” title and legal firm subplot, once again operating simply as “Binneland” for this period. The focus returned to the Binneland Kliniek, a private hospital in Pretoria, South Africa. Early episodes showed Stefanie dealing with the aftermath of Rian’s coma, including issues surrounding his will and a potential operation. Dr. Dylan continued to mentor young patients. Dr. Tertius Jonker considered significant career and personal decisions. Pippa Venter navigated complex situations involving Daleen and Malan. The narrative explored the everyday pressures of hospital life alongside the staff’s personal relationships, rivalries, and internal clinic politics. These storylines established a renewed emphasis on medical drama and character-driven conflicts.
Binnelanders – Season 7 Cast, Characters, and Arc
The seventh season featured a core ensemble cast, many of whom were long-standing members of the series. Hans Strydom played Dr. At Koster, a consistent presence in the clinic’s hierarchy. Sandi Schultz appeared as Dr. Jennifer Adams, whose character faced challenges related to rehabilitation and career shifts during this period. Reynardt Hugo returned as Dr. Tertius Jonker, navigating new romantic interests and professional choices. Nadia Valvekens portrayed Pippa Venter, often involved in the hospital’s administrative and personal dramas. Hykie Berg was Dr. Conrad Bester, a key figure in the clinic’s medical operations. Other notable returning players included Je-ani Swiegelaar as Naomi Koster and Desiré Gardner as Daleen Jonker. The season’s return to a hospital-centric narrative gave these characters arcs that emphasized their roles within the Binneland Kliniek, addressing both their medical duties and personal lives.

How Binnelanders – Season 7 Fits the Series
Season 7 represented a significant formatting adjustment for the Binnelanders series. Prior to this season, the show had expanded into a one-hour daily soap titled “Binneland Sub Judice,” which incorporated a legal firm storyline. For Season 7, the series reverted to its original half-hour daily format and was temporarily renamed “Binneland.” This change signaled a return to the core hospital drama at Binneland Kliniek, moving away from the legal elements that defined the previous season. The shift was intended to refocus the narrative on the medical and interpersonal relationships among the hospital staff and patients. This realignment helped solidify the show’s identity as a medical soap opera, a format it largely maintained in subsequent years.
